C++ 비쥬얼 스튜디오 컴파일 하기
관련링크
본문
프로그램은 어떻게 작성하는지 빌드는 어떻게 하는지 쭉 알아보도록 하죠.
visual studio 2012에 들어가면 다음과 같이 실행이 됩니다. 참 깔끔한게 마음에 듭니다. ㅎ
이제 프로그램을 작성하기 위한 바탕을 만들어 줘야 합니다.
프로젝트명과 소스파일을 만들어줘야 하죠.
[파일] - [새로 만들기] - [프로젝트]로 들어갑니다.
Win32 콘솔 응용 프로그램을 선택하고
이름과 위치를 정해주신다음에 확인을 눌러줍니다.
확인을 눌으시면 다음과 같은 창이 뜹니다.
다음을 눌으시면 아래과 같은 창이 나오는데요.
여기서 빈 프로젝트에 체크를 하시고 [마침] 을 눌러주시면 됩니다.
이제 프로젝트는 만들었으니 소스 파일을 만들어 줘야 합니다. 프로그램의 소스를 작성하기 위해서 말이죠.
마침을 눌으셨으면 왼쪽에 다음과 같은것들이 생성되었을겁니다.
여기서 [소스 파일] - [오른쪽 마우스 클릭] - [추가] - [새 항목] 을 눌러주세요.
C++ 파일 (.cpp)를 선택하시고 이름에서 C언어를 공부할것이므로 이름.c 라고 하시면 됩니다.
.cpp는 c++소스를 작성하는 겁니다. c소스를 작성하는 것이 아닙니다.
이렇게 소스를 작성할 수 있는 공간이 마련되었습니다.
이곳에 소스를 작성하고 컴파일, 링크를 하면 됩니다.
소스를 작성하고 난 다음에 [빌드] - [컴파일]을 하시면 컴파일이 됩니다.
컴파일하는 과정에서 오류가 없다면 밑에서 빌드 : 성공 1 실패 0 최신 0 생략 0 이라고 나옵니다.
그다음 링크를 합니다.
[빌드] - [솔루션 빌드]를 하시면 링크를 하게 됩니다.
이렇게 하면 소스의 컴파일과 링크는 끝나게 됩니다.
하지만 이것이 엄청 귀찮습니다. 컴파일 따로 링크 따로 하는게 불편하니 단축키를 외워두는게 좋습니다.
F7을 눌으시면 바로 솔루션 빌드가 됩니다.
F7을해서 오류가 나지 않는다면 Ctrl + F5를 눌러서 프로그램을 실행합니다.
이런식으로 프로그램을 만듭니다.
※ 링크 : 컴파일된 코드를 라이브러리 파일과 연결시켜 주는 단계
※ 위 캡처 사진에서 소스가 잘못되어있습니다.
#include <stdio.h>
int main(void)
{
....
}
입니다.
출처: http://keybreak.tistory.com/64 [KEYBREAK]